For the 2026-27 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 521 students in 16428, PA.
Public high school in zipcode 16428 have an average math proficiency score of 75% (versus the Pennsylvania public high school average of 30%).
Public high school in zipcode 16428 have a Graduation Rate of 87%, which is less than the Pennsylvania average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is North East High School, with 85-89%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Pennsylvania or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Pennsylvania public high school average of 40% (majority Hispanic and Black).
